While the hotel is conveniently located near Shenyang Station's high-speed rail, the area outside is swarming with an alarming number of crows! You're constantly at risk of bird droppings falling from above, and the ground is covered in them.
Upon check-in, the hotel staff asked for my passport and also insisted on a facial scan. I told them that I've stayed at many hotels across China and have never been asked for a photo, except for checking into scenic areas where a facial scan is sometimes required for continuous entry. No other hotels have ever made this demand. Only this Atour X Hotel at Shenyang Station had this requirement. About 4 or 5 front desk staff members all claimed it was mandated by the public security bureau.
I explained that I could understand if their government departments required all foreign travelers to do this, or if all hotels nationwide uniformly enforced it – I would have no complaints. But the problem is that the government doesn't mandate all travelers and hotels to do this. So why is only *your* hotel requiring it?
They even told me to call 110 to inquire. I did, and the police officer said he wasn't clear and would transfer me to another department who would call me back. That department then called me, and I explained the situation, but they also said they weren't clear and would have *another* department call me. I asked, if your country truly mandates this, why is no one aware? It's just one department transferring me to another. Isn't that extremely strange? And with so many online scams nowadays, your hotel wants a facial scan *and* passport details. This is an unreasonable request.
This wasted our time as consumers and caused us significant trouble. So, who would want to stay at their hotel again? In the end, I believe their supervisor or manager intervened and said the facial scan wasn't necessary, and only then were we allowed to check in. They apologized afterward, but I felt it was already too late.
